Is it OK to put PS4 on glass?

It doesn't matter whether you put your PS4 on glass, wood, marble, brick, linoleum tiling, or whatever other random material you can think of. What's more important is keeping the space on the sides and back of the console open so it can properly vent the heat out. Avoid cabinet style TV stands and you'll be good.

What is the oldest console ever?

Odyssey series

In 1972 Magnavox released the world's first home video game console, the Magnavox Odyssey. It came packaged with board game paraphernalia such as cards, paper money and dice to enhance the games.

Why is my PS4 so loud?

If your PS4 is too hot, the fan spins and very likely gets much louder than normal. If there're something on or around your PS4 console, move them away. Then wait for a while to see if your console cools down and gets quiet. Just leave enough space around the back and sides of your PS4 for airflow.
